    I agree with Glen and would strongly consider a 4" barrel as well.  Either  a Ruger GP100 or S&W 686 should do the job!  For a shorter barrel maybe the S&W 66 Combat Magnum w/ a 2.5" barrel or an older blued Model 19.  The K and L frame sizes are sweet!  An SP101 in a larger caliber would work, but unless you update the grip it probably won't be that confortable to shoot as Scorpio 64 pointed out and the larger K and L frames would work better for recoil.  Similar in size to the K frames are the Ruger Sixes that are in between the Ruger GP100 and SP101 in size and close to a S&W L frame.   Drum role please...

    Here is my recommendation... If you don't mind a little shorter than the 3" requirements you can get an OLDER and AWESOME Ruger Speed Six with a 2.75" barrel and round butt frame and fixed sights and nice balance.  If you are really lucky a rare Postal Inspecter model (GS33-PS) with a coveted 3" barrel is out there somewhere.  You could even find the Speed Sixes at a premium price in 9mm and moon clips that would keep your ammo consistent, but that variety would kick more than the .38s.  Yes, you might find some value in one of the older Ruger Sixes and that's what I would look for with your 3" (2.75" requirement).  Look into the Security Sixes and Services Sixes as well.  Not sure, but they should have equivalent barrel length and perhaps adjustable sights if that is something you want.  If you were thinking that the 3" might work to  carry later on then the  2.75" barrel will be even that much better!  If I was going to carry a revolver and didn't pickup one of those polymer Rugers the Speed Six would be my first choice!   Perhaps the only negatives are that you might be limited in grips if you don't like the one that is stock and S&W K-frame holsters should work.  Pachmyr Gripper Grips are nice and Hogue probably has something to still offer as well.  I always wanted to find a bicentennial model stamped with "Made in the 200th year of American Liberty" Speed Six!  Not sure if Ruger will still service these relatively bomb-proof revolvers, though, so there is that.

    For a "budget" revolver I would consider a Taurus 66 6 or 7 shot with a 4" in barrel and a supposed lifetime warranty.  These are decent quality and similar to their S&W counterpart with a slightly less desirable trigger.  Rutger's 95 has a good suggestion in the smaller Taurus as well.  

    As for a soft-shooting 9mm semi-auto, consider one of the CZ 75 flavors, and the matte stainless model would be a nice rendition, or possibly an alternative, a Baby Eagle Jericho 941 or one of the older metal Smiths such as the 39 semi-auto.  Redeye's suggestion of a PX4 would be nice as well; I've always wanted a compact PX4!  If I remember there was a South American company besides Beretta that had a similar rotary design but the brand//model escapes me.
